1978 Sun Belt Conference Tournament
The 1978 Sun Belt Conference baseball tournament was held April 28 - 30 in Mobile, AL. #2 University of New Orleans defeated #4 University of South Florida for the title. Roy Weimer of New Orleans was named tournament MVP.
Participating Teams[edit]
Seed | School | Overall Record | Head Coach |
---|---|---|---|
1 | University of South Alabama | 38-14 | Eddie Stanky |
2 | University of New Orleans | 35-16 | Ron Maestri |
3 | Jacksonville University | 35-28 | Jack Lamabe |
4 | University of South Florida | 25-26 | Robin Roberts |

Game Results[edit]
Game | Winner | Score | Loser | Notes |
---|---|---|---|---|
Game 1 | University of New Orleans | 3-2 | Jacksonville University | |
Game 2 | University of South Florida | 13-5 | University of South Alabama | |
Game 3 | University of South Alabama | 9-7 | Jacksonville University | Jacksonville eliminated |
Game 4 | University of New Orleans | 12-8 | University of South Florida | |
Game 5 | University of South Florida | 10-5 | University of South Alabama | South Alabama eliminated |
Game 6 | University of South Florida | 2-1 | University of New Orleans | |
Game 7 | University of New Orleans | 14-7 | University of South Florida | New Orleans wins Sun Belt Conference title |
